Our clients practice was formed in 1997 to offer consulting services on all aspects of ground engineering, including the assessment and remediation of contaminated land.
They offer a combined approach to geotechnical and geoenvironmental site assessment and this helps them to provide the most thorough and cost-effective service for their clients. This can result in sites that have previously been considered economically unviable becoming profitable development opportunities.
They are now looking to recruit a Graduate Geotechnical Engineer to join their busy team.
Duties and Responsibilities• Desk study enquiries• On site investigation works including logging of samples, specialist sampling for geotechnical and analytical testing and supervision of contractors• On-site monitoring and measurement
Graduate Engineer, under direction from a Project Director/Manager, is responsible for carrying out:• Preparation of laboratory testing schedules• Preparation of factual and interpretative aspects of site investigation reports• Supervision and direction of specialist geotechnical/environmental/groundworks contractors and preparation of completion/validation reports• Qualitative and quantitative analysis of geotechnical and environmental designs including computer based analysis• Detailed design of geotechnical and environmental solutions including foundations, retaining walls, earthworks, remediation schemes, monitoring programmes
Graduate Engineer shall:
• Be aware of Health and Safety Law and Environmental Law responsibilities• Ensure he/she is undertaking continuing professional development by reading journals, attending seminars and attending courses.
